KCR Should Not Treat Telangana As His ‘Jagir’: Uttam

Hyderabad, May 6 (Maxim News): TPCC President N. Uttam Kumar Reddy said Chief Minister K. Chandrashekhar Rao has crossed all limits of decency while targeting Congress party during his press conference at Pragathi Bhavan on Tuesday.

Addressing a press conference at Gandhi Bhavan on Wednesday, Uttam Kumar Reddy said that the language used by KCR to insult the Congress leaders does not match the stature of a Chief Minister. He said during 30 years of his political career he had not seen any Chief Minister who stooped down to such a low level to target his political opponents. He said it was unfortunate that a person who began his career as a ‘Passport broker’ was calling Congress leaders ‘brokers’. “Would we not call a person a ‘buffoon’ who went on record in Assembly stating that Coronavirus could be treated with a Paracetamol tablet?” he asked.

Uttam Kumar Reddy said that the Chief Minister has imposed salary cut for all employees and even reduced pensioners’ pay by half citing financial problems. However, he said thousands of crores were paid to various contractors in the same month. He alleged that KCR was robbing the Telangana’s exchequer to benefit the Andhra contractors.

He said KCR was no more sensitive to the problems being faced by the people due to the arrogance of power. He said KCR family no more travels by regular flights and they hire chartered flights even for personal tours at the cost of public exchequer.

Uttam Kumar Reddy said that CM KCR has shown utter disrespect to the institution of Governor by criticising the representation submitted by Congress party to Governor Dr. Tamilisai Soundararajan. He said KCR should be ashamed for wrongly stating that Congress leaders were expecting a higher death toll due to Coroanvirus. He said KCR himself should have read the representation submitted to the Governor wherein Congress questioned less number of tests being conducted on Covid-19 suspects. He said KCR has proudly mentioned that the recovery rate of Coronavirus patients in Telangana was higher. At the same time, KCR should have mentioned the testing rate in Telangana State compared to other States and national average. “KCR gets angry when someone approaches the court or meet the Governor with complaints. This shows his dislike for democratic practices and inclination towards dictatorial form of government,” he said.

The TPCC Chief also accused CM KCR making false claims on Telangana being the only State procuring agricultural produce from the farmers. He said Chattisgarh and other Congress-ruled States not only waived off crop loans of farmers, but purchased the agriculture produce by paying prices above MSP. He challenged KCR to visit Chattisgarh to study the procurement process. He said that the TRS Government neither waived off the promised crop loans nor it procured the agriculture produce from farmers. He asked KCR to clarify as to when his government paid financial assistance to farmers under Rythu Bandhu scheme before the commencement of crop season. He said KCR never honoured his own words and promises throughout his life and career. He said KCR himself claimed in a press conference that Sweet Lime was good for health. However, he said that the State Government was not purchasing the Sweet Lime to help the farmers.

Uttam Kumar Reddy also condemned KCR for the ‘love’ he has shown towards ‘wine’ and ‘wine shops’. He said opening of wine shops was allowed even in Red Zones. He slammed the Chief Minister for not having any clue on the exact number of migrant workers in Telangana State. He said the migrant workers were not provided the promised help and for the same reason they were insisting on returning to their native States.

He said that KCR should not consider Telangana as his ‘jagir’ (personal fiefdom) just because his party has won the last elections.

TPCC Working President Ponnam Prabhakar, AICC Kisan Cell Vice President M. Kodanda Reddy, MLA Jagga Reddy and PCC ex-President V. Hanumantha Rao also spoke during the press conference. TPCC Covid-19 Task Force Chairman Marri Shashidhar Reddy, TPCC Treasurer Gudur Narayana Reddy and other leaders were also present. (Maxim News)
